Promise: Strengthen Campus Safety and Emergency Preparedness

✓ Promise Kept

• Upgraded security cameras throughout the district.

• Partnered with law enforcement to enhance school safety measures

• Installed new campus-wide intercom systems.

• Expanded ALICE safety training for staff and students.

• Improved emergency response planning and preparedness across all schools.

Promise: Protect taxpayer dollars and ensure responsible stewardship. 

✓ Promise Kept

  • Drafted and passed a resolution increasing fiscal accountability and transparency
  • Created a public website housing all fiscal documents — contracts, bargaining agreements, audits, and more
  • Balanced the district budget all four years

Promise: Strengthen civic engagement and honor foundational American traditions.
✓ Promise Kept

  • Restored the Pledge of Allegiance in classrooms across the district
  • Expanded career pathways and opportunities for students interested in serving in the armed services 
  • Helped bring the State Seal of Civic Engagement to PUHSD in 2024/2025, recognizing students who demonstrate strong civic knowledge and participation
